                         TITLE 43--PUBLIC LANDS
 
  CHAPTER 12--RECLAMATION AND IRRIGATION OF LANDS BY FEDERAL GOVERNMENT
 
              SUBCHAPTER IV--CONSTRUCTION OF SMALL PROJECTS
 
Sec. 422c. Proposals; submission; payment for cost of 
        examination
        
    Any organization desiring to avail itself of the benefits provided 
in this subchapter shall submit a proposal therefor to the Secretary in 
such form and manner as he shall prescribe. Each such proposal shall be 
accompanied by a payment of $5,000 to defray, in part, the cost of 
examining the proposal.

(Aug. 6, 1956, ch. 972, Sec. 3, 70 Stat. 1044; Pub. L. 99-546, title 
III, Sec. 303, Oct. 27, 1986, 100 Stat. 3053.)


                               Amendments

    1986--Pub. L. 99-546 substituted ``$5,000'' for ``$1,000''.
